GENERAL COMMENTS

Packer inquiry in cattle feeding count remains relatively guarded with just a few bids noted in the early going (i.e., $118 in parts of the South). Asking prices are around $125 in the South and $200 in the North. Significant trade volume may not surface until sometime Thursday or Friday. The cash hog trade has opened mostly steady bids. Currently, the corn trade is about a penny higher in light trade volume. The stock market is making history this morning with the Dow finally crossing the 20,000 threshold. The Dow is 119 points higher at this writing with the Nasdaq better by 38.

LIVE CATTLE:

The live trade continues to nurse a listless tone this morning with most contracts 10-42 lower through the opening hour of business. Spot Feb is now close to $3 below last week's cash market.

It may be tough for the board to fall further away from the country trade without concrete evidence of bearish news. Open interest on Tuesday increased by 4,930 (349,402). Spot February liquidated by 1,625 (50,371) and April jumped by 3,245 (145,159). DTN projected slaughter for today is 113,000 head.

FEEDER CATTLE:

Feeder futures are mixed this morning, ranging from up 10 to off 32. Players here seem to be waiting for marching order from counterparts in the live futures market. Open interest on Tuesday increased by 304 (52,109). CME cash feeder Index for 01/23: 133.28, off .18.

LEAN HOGS:

Bulls seem to be coming back to life in the lean hog market, at least for the moment. Prices currently range from 20 to 167 higher with nearbys gaining on deferreds. The front-end is being supported by cash premiums, bull spreading interest, and Tuesday $2 surge is the pork carcass value. Open interest on Tuesday decreased 1,787 (215,168). Spot February liquidated by 1,543 (29,245) and April lost 1,000 (98,064). CME cash lean index for 0l/23: 67.23, up 0.18. DTN projected slaughter for today is 435,000 head.
